You are an expert leadership coach specializing in software development teams. Create a comprehensive, actionable plan to increase motivation and instill a strong sense of personal control among [specify number or 'my'] development personnel. Tailor it to a [describe team context, e.g., 'remote agile team of 10 senior developers working on web apps']. Follow this exact structure for your response: 1. **Assess Current State**: Analyze common motivation challenges in development teams and identify 3-5 key pain points based on the provided context. - Bullet key insights with evidence-based reasons. - Suggest a quick team survey (3-5 questions) to validate. 2. **Motivation Boost Strategies**: Provide 5 proven, step-by-step tactics to elevate motivation levels. - For each tactic: Describe the method, expected benefits, implementation timeline (e.g., immediate, 1 week), and metrics for success (e.g., track via Jira velocity). - Incorporate elements like gamification, recognition, and skill-building workshops. 3. **Empower Personal Control**: Outline 4 initiatives to foster autonomy and ownership. - Bullet details: How-to steps, tools/resources (e.g., OKRs, pair programming), potential obstacles and solutions. - Emphasize decision-making freedom and self-directed projects. 4. **Implementation Roadmap**: Deliver a 4-week rollout plan with weekly milestones. - Use a table format: Week | Actions | Responsible | KPIs. 5. **Long-Term Sustainment**: Recommend 3 habits for ongoing culture building. - Include follow-up check-ins and adjustment tips. Ensure the plan is practical, evidence-based (reference psychology like Self-Determination Theory), and drives measurable results in productivity, retention, and innovation. End with a motivational team message template.
